Does it vibrate through the cabin? I took an 6MT M4 for a quick test drive and I found it to glide over the road imperfections better compared to my 911.
No is definitely doesn't vibrate. It's well built and screwed down tight. It's not harsh, just very firm. I think it's the nature of front engine vs rear or mid engine vehicles nowadays. They have to make front engine cars' suspension stiff to compete with the natural balance of its rear/mid engine competitors, i.e. cayman/911/c8 vette. You'll hear repeatedly from experts that C8 vettes are almost rolls Royce smooth in comfort setting with magneride shocks. It's tough to do have world-beating handling AND a plush ride with front engine architecture. I haven't driven the new vette yet, so can't comment, just know that my base 911 with standard suspension was probably as comfortable as a GTI for reference.
Ironically I actually find my M3 feels smoother over the road than the GTI I had a few years back. The GTI was super fun, small, and light, but didn't feel particularly planted as a result (FWD didn't help)
